Project Overview

The project on CPVC (Chlorinated Polyvinyl Chloride) and SWR (Soil, Waste, and Rain) pipes and fittings investigates the market landscape and technological advancements in the sector of plastic pipe fittings. CPVC pipes are commonly used for hot and cold water distribution, whereas SWR pipes are ideal for drainage systems. The research delineates the properties, production techniques, and applications of these materials, emphasizing their durability, corrosion resistance, and versatility in various environmental conditions. Moreover, the project includes an analysis of the manufacturing processes such as extrusion and injection molding, which are pivotal in the production of consistent and high-quality pipe fittings. The market for CPVC and SWR pipes is expanding due to urbanization, increasing demand for residential and commercial infrastructure, and growing awareness regarding water conservation and management. Environmental concerns also drive the transition towards more sustainable piping solutions. Overall, this report provides comprehensive insights into trends, market dynamics, and competitive analyses essential for stakeholders in the plastic pipe manufacturing industry.

SWOT Analysis

Strengths

  • High resistance to corrosion and temperature variations
  • Durable and long-lasting materials
  • Lightweight, making transportation and installation easier

Weaknesses

  • Higher cost compared to traditional materials like galvanized steel
  • Flammability concerns with some types of plastic pipes
  • Limited awareness among consumers about advantages over PVC

Opportunities

  • Expansion into emerging markets with infrastructural needs
  • Innovations in product development for special applications
  • Partnerships with construction firms for bulk supply contracts

Threats

  • Competition from alternative piping materials such as HDPE and traditional metals
  • Regulatory changes affecting production standards
  • Market volatility due to fluctuating raw material prices
